"Forth" is a strong album that showcases The Verve's unique sound and musicianship. The album features a mix of slower, more contemplative tracks and upbeat, driving tracks, which creates a nice balance of energy and emotion. The album's lyrics touch on a variety of themes, including love, loss, addiction, and personal growth, which adds depth and complexity to the songs. The album's impact on the music industry was significant, as it marked The Verve's return to music after a long hiatus and showcased their continued relevance and creativity.
Track-by-Track Analysis
Sit and Wonder
The album begins with the track "Sit and Wonder," which features a slow, atmospheric intro that builds into a full-band explosion. Ashcroft's vocals soar over the instrumentation, and the lyrics touch on themes of self-reflection and the search for meaning.
Love is Noise
"Love is Noise" is the album's lead single and most popular track. The song features a catchy guitar riff and driving rhythm section. The lyrics focus on the theme of love and its power to transform.
Rather Be
"Rather Be" is a slower, more contemplative track that features acoustic guitars and a melancholic melody. The lyrics focus on the desire to escape from the struggles of everyday life.
Judas
"Judas" is a more upbeat track that features a driving rhythm section and energetic guitar riffs. The lyrics touch on themes of betrayal and loss.
Numbness
"Numbness" is a slower, more atmospheric track that features a haunting melody and sparse instrumentation. The lyrics focus on the feeling of being disconnected from the world.
I See Houses
"I See Houses" is a more experimental track that features electronic instrumentation and a spoken-word vocal delivery. The lyrics touch on themes of urban decay and social isolation.
Noise Epic
"Noise Epic" is an instrumental track that features a complex arrangement of guitars, keyboards, and drums. The track showcases the band's musicianship and experimental approach to music.
Valium Skies
"Valium Skies" is a slower, more contemplative track that features acoustic guitars and a mournful melody. The lyrics touch on themes of addiction and emotional pain.
Columbo
"Columbo" is an upbeat track that features driving guitars and a catchy chorus. The lyrics touch on themes of personal growth and self-realization.
Appalachian Springs
The album ends with the track "Appalachian Springs," which features a slow, atmospheric intro that builds into a full-band explosion. The lyrics touch on themes of hope and the power of nature to heal.
